Question

multiple choice question
which structure regulates primitive functions including hunger, thirst, thermoregulation, emotions, and sexuality?
o cerebellum
o spinal cord
o hypothalamus
o superior colliculus

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

The hypothalamus is a key brain structure that plays a crucial role in regulating primitive functions. It is involved in maintaining homeostasis, which includes controlling hunger (by regulating food intake), thirst (by managing fluid balance), thermoregulation (keeping body temperature stable), emotions (through its connections with the limbic system), and aspects of sexuality (by influencing hormonal and behavioral aspects related to it). The cerebellum is mainly involved in motor control, balance, and coordination. The spinal cord is a major pathway for neural signals between the body and the brain and is involved in reflex actions. The superior colliculus is mainly related to visual - motor functions and eye movements.

Answer:

hypothalamus
